US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"transaction frequency"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ts related to finance, business, or data analysis to refer to how often transactions occur within a specific timeframe. Example: "The transaction frequency increased significantly during the holiday season, indicating a surge in consumer spending."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When discussing financial data or business metrics, use "transaction frequency" to clearly indicate how often transactions occur within a defined period, providing a quantifiable measure of activity.

Common error

Avoid using "transaction frequency" when you actually mean "transaction volume". Frequency refers to how often transactions occur, while volume refers to the total number or size of the transactions. Using the terms interchangeably can lead to misinterpretations of the data.

FAQs

How is "transaction frequency" measured?

"Transaction frequency" is typically measured as the number of transactions occurring within a specific time frame, such as daily, monthly, or annually. This metric provides insights into activity levels and trends over time.

What does a high "transaction frequency" indicate?

A high "transaction frequency" usually suggests strong user engagement, efficient processes, or a thriving market. It can also point to potential risks in high-frequency trading scenarios or vulnerabilities in systems dealing with numerous rapid transactions.

Which is a more appropriate alternative: "transaction rate" or "frequency of transactions"?

Both "transaction rate" and "frequency of transactions" are suitable alternatives to "transaction frequency", depending on the context. "Transaction rate" might imply a sense of speed, while "frequency of transactions" provides a slightly more formal tone.

How does "transaction frequency" differ from "average transaction size"?

"Transaction frequency" measures how often transactions occur, whereas "average transaction size" refers to the average monetary value of each transaction. They provide different insights: frequency indicates activity, and average size indicates value per transaction.
